Enstar Group appoints Poul Winslow and Hans-Peter Gerhardt to its Board as Independent Directors

– BERMUDA, Hamilton – Enstar Group Limited (Nasdaq:ESGR) announced the appointment of two new independent directors, Poul A. Winslow and Hans-Peter Gerhardt.

Mr. Winslow has been the Head of Thematic Investments and External Portfolio Management of Canada Pension Plan Investment Board (“CPPIB”) since 2009. Prior to joining CPPIB, Mr. Winslow had several senior management and investment roles at Nordea Investment Management in Denmark, Sweden and the USA. He also served as the Chief Investment Officer for Andra AP-Fonden (AP2) in Sweden. He will serve as a member of Enstar’s Investment and Compensation Committees.

Mr. Gerhardt has served continuously in the reinsurance industry since 1981. He is a co-founder and former Chief Executive Officer of PARIS RE Holdings Limited, holding that position from the company’s formation in 2006 through its sale to PartnerRe Ltd. in December 2009. He was the Chief Executive Officer of AXA Re (the predecessor to PARIS RE) from 2003 to 2006, also serving as Chairman of AXA Liabilities Managers, a run-off operation, during that time. He will serve as the Chairman of Enstar’s Underwriting and Risk Committee.

Enstar Group Limited and its operating subsidiaries acquire and manage diversified insurance businesses through a network of service companies in Bermuda, the United States, the United Kingdom, Continental Europe, Australia, and other international locations. Enstar is a market leader in completing legacy acquisitions, having acquired over 65 companies and portfolios since its formation in 2001. Enstar’s active underwriting businesses include the Atrium group of companies, which manage and underwrite specialist insurance and reinsurance business for Lloyd’s Syndicate 609, and the StarStone group of companies, an A- rated global specialty insurance group with multiple global underwriting platforms.
